Output 66df0586ec38ecac7f022ff22e5eea198828a57d9fdd1543d3480fab77167474:1

value
716277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b4d9ad9ef30e6a6b012765242df0383ef27ed4 OP_EQUAL
address
3KFxK5HaoG3h2aXJwnmE3SHpJ5YVSjy4MQ
transaction
66df0586ec38ecac7f022ff22e5eea198828a57d9fdd1543d3480fab77167474
confirmations
269982
spent
true